Hawk wrote:
That only applies to newer video cards and drivers. I have 3 monitors set up on 2 GeForce 7600 GT KO cards but they're not set up for SLI because multi-monitors will not work on the old cards I have if SLI'd. I know! I've tried. *!sad!*


Same here with 2 x GeForce 9800 GTX and 3 monitors.
I have to run most of the time with SLI disabled, and manually enable it in the Nvidia control panel for the few games that need SLI. It screws up my monitor setup every time I go back to 3-monitor mode, but I use ultramon for easily restoring the setup.

I wish there was a way to automatically enable / disable SLI instead of manually.

Ultramon, huh? I ought have to give that a try. I've been using Display Fusion, although I do like it, I'm always willing to try something new.

Edit 1: I do see one major difference between Ultrmon and Display Fusion. It looks like Ultramon will only display one background image per monitor on each of the monitors where Display Fusion allows you to set up folders with more than one image in each folder for the monitors.
I have three folders set up. Each has about 200 images in them and I can adjust how often the background changes on each monitor.

Plus Display Fusion is $15.00 cheaper.
